Lacktman Quoted on Personalized Medicine in Florida
January 28, 2011
Tampa Bay Business Journal
Foley Senior Counsel Nathaniel Lacktman was quoted in an article that appeared in the Tampa Bay Business Journal on January 28, 2011 titled “Clinical trials seen as driving economic sector; M2Gen’s presence helping.” Lacktman discusses the efforts of M2Gen, the for-profit subsidiary of Moffitt Cancer Center, to help position the Tampa Bay region as a national leader in drug development. He states that M2Gen’s work should draw drug developers, physicians and other service providers to the area.
